Hadith 6954
Lady Aisha Siddiqa (may Allah be pleased with her) narrates: During the illness in which the Prophet Muhammad (peace be upon him) passed away, he called Lady Fatimah (may Allah be pleased with her). The Prophet (peace be upon him) whispered something to her, and she began to weep. Then he called her again and whispered something else to her, and she began to laugh. Lady Aisha (may Allah be pleased with her) narrates: Later, I asked Fatimah about this, and she replied: The Prophet (peace be upon him) first whispered to me that he would pass away during this illness, so I began to weep. Then the Prophet (peace be upon him) whispered to me that I would be the first among his family to join him, so I laughed.
